Mr. S. Saktivel Muruganantham:
Born into an illustrious family of musicians. Muruganantham is one of South India's finest percussionists. He has been playing the mridangam(South Indian drum)for my dance, for ten years. The mridangam is an integral part of a classical dance performance, rhythm plays a vital role. Muruganantham is a master of rhythm and has not only been able to follow the intricate footwork which is charecteristic of Valli's dance, but he is also able to embellish the dance with rhythmic improvisations.
This talented percussionist has accompanied Valli on many of her tours abroad and has played for her at many of India's most prestigious festivals. He has performed as a member of her group at major International festivals like the The Theatre de la Ville Festival in Paris, The Bergen Festival, The Madrid Festival, The Venice Biennale, The San Antonio Theatre Festival, Pina Bausch's Wuppertal Tanz Theater Festival in Germany, The festival at the Royal Albert Hall for the joint celebrations of the 50th Anniversary of Independence opf India and Pakistan.
Muruganantham has performed widely both in India and abroad, as a member of Valli's group and also with many famous dancers like Ms.Chithra Visveshwaran. He has also won recognition and merit as a very fine teacher of percussion and has many talented students. He has also had the honour of performing with Valli before the King and Queen of Norway, Queen Beatrix of Netherlands and Prince Charles of England. He is an invaluable member of Valli's orchestra.
Mr. C.K Vasudevan:
Vasudevan Is an extremely talented percussionist who has trained under the renowned maestro Mr. Umayalpuram Sivaraman. He is also Valli's student in the fine art of Nattuvangam, which involves the use of cymbals and the uttering of rhythmic solfa syllables. It is a very difficult art that Vasudevan has mastered to perfection in the ten years that he has been Valli's student. Valli has trained him specially in the rhythmic intricacies and nuances of her particular school of dance - The Pandanallur tradition
and he has been an asset in her performances for the last eight years.
Vasudevan has performed widely with Valli in the major festivals and theatres of India, like The Elephanta Caves Festival, the Ellora Festival, The Music Academy festival in Madras, The Kala Goda Festival, The Khajuraho Festival, The Soorya Festival, to name but a few. He has also accompanied Valli abroad, to perform at The Venice Biennale in Italy, at the San Antonio Festival in Texas and at the Neelan Thiruchelvam Commemoration Festival in Sri Lanka. Vasudevan also regularly performs for Government functions and as an accompanist for Indian Television programmes-Doordarshan.
Nattuvangam is an art that requires total co-ordination between dancer and nattuvanar. In his many years of study and work with Valli, Vasudevan has understood her dance and its nuances. He is therefore, one of very few accompanists who can interpret the inticacies of Valli's personal dance style.
Ms. AKKARAI S. SUBHALAKSHMI:
Akkarai S. Subhalakshmi, a child prodigy, started giving violin solo and vocal performances at the age of eight. She is today a well recognised violinist, with an extensive repertoire to her credit, who has performed in leading music festivals in India. She has provided violin accompaniment to many leading solo concert singers. Subhalakshmi has also been featured frequently on the National Television Networks in Madras, Delhi and other cities in India.
Akkarai Subhalakshmi has won the DELHI STATE FIRST AWARD in a vocal competition in 1994, conducted by the SANGAM KALA GROUP. She has won 6 Gold
medals and two silver medals from the NEHRU BAL SAMITI New Delhi (both for vocal and violin) and she has been awarded the KALA SHREE AWARD in 1995 by the same institution. She is a holder of the CCRT (Centre for cultural Resources & Training) talent scholarship since 1994 for her violin expertise.
She has accompanied Alarmel Valli, as a member of the orchestra, to leading International Festivals like - The Niigata Asian Cultural Festival in Japan, the Bologna Festival, the Berlin International Festival, the Festivals in Reggio Emilia and Ferrara in Italy, Remschied in Germany and Angers in France. Alarmel Valli will be presenting her as a soloist, at the famous Theatre de la Ville in Paris in April 2002, during Alarmel Valli's own performance series in that Theatre.
Gomathi Nayagam:
A talented young vocalist of the classical Carnatic (South Indian) music tradition, Gomathi Nayagam has a Master's Degree in Music from the University of Madras (South India). He has also had advanced training in singing, under renowned musicians - Mr. B Rajam Iyer and Mrs. R Vedavalli. He has received a Higher Teacher's Training Diploma from the Teacher's College of Music, of the prestigious Music Academy, Madras and also completed Grade VIII in Western Music, from The Trinity College of Music, London. Mr. Nayagam has been singing professionally for the past eight years
and performed in many leading cultural venues in Madras and other Indian cities. He has also had the privilege to perform along with the maestro B. Rajam Iyer, at many of his concerts. The renowned Music Academy of Madras has recognised his talent in various music competitions and awarded him prizes.
Currently, Gomathi Nayagam is a member of the orchestra of internationally acclaimed Bharatanatyam dancer Alarmel Valli and has been studying and working on Dance Music with her. He has also been invited by her to be a staff member of 'Dipasikha - A Centre for the Performing Arts.
